lzhpsky
工控小菜鳥
級別: 論壇先鋒
|
我用EM231熱電阻模塊的AIW0接著K型熱電偶,Q0.0接的固態繼電器,用PID向導做了個溫度控制,有幾個地方不明白。 1.對于我這個試驗,在向導中的過程變量的低限和高限的設定有什么要求嗎?我這樣設定可以嗎?實際要控制水溫在50度的恒定。 2.如果按照我向導的設定數值,我在PID塊中的setpoint參數里寫入50.0,是不是就是設定目標溫度50度的意思呢? 3.PID做好了,實際監控恒定在55度左右,我設定的是50度,要高出5度,我試著往水杯里加水,溫度降到50后,為什么PLC馬上就輸出了,溫度馬上又上去了,有恒定在55度了,這是為什么? 請大家解答一下我這幾個疑問,謝謝 [ 此帖被lzhpsky在2011-08-08 16:47重新編輯 ] |
---|---|
|
lzhpsky
工控小菜鳥
級別: 論壇先鋒
|
大家看這個調節面板,我設定值設置成45,為什么溫度又在50度左右徘徊呢?感覺好像差5度,是不是哪里沒設置好? |
---|---|
|
巍雙子座
級別: *
|
上下限可實現報警控制,至于你的溫度控制不準,可能有兩點原因:1、你的PID調節不行,P I設的太大,造成溫度過沖太多,你可以試著減小, 2就是你的溫度傳感器有誤差 |
---|---|
|
lsklee
級別: *
|
溫度設定值太低吧,你看你的輸出占空比都成0了,溫度實際值一直比設定值大,加熱器是不能降溫的。如果是超調大的話就是積分時間太小,可是積分時間夠大了, |
---|---|
|
chenyu4322
級別: *
|
5樓
發表于: 2011-08-16 11:36
本身這種控制方式就不對,在輸出的時候應該控制模擬量來控制溫度,也就是開關量控制在停止的時候溫度會向上沖得,得用晶閘管控制比較精確! |
---|---|
|
weilinyi
級別: 工控俠客
|
你這肯定有問題,就是水太少、加熱管太大、加熱管就有熱貫性、試用小桶裝水試一下、再調一下PID |
---|---|
|
guolibin
auto_glb@qq.com
級別: VIP會員
|
硬件系統設計沒問題,SSR可以用來控溫,PWM控溫。 控溫不準就是PID參數的問題。 |
---|---|
|